We establish asymptotic formulae for the number of biquadratic number fields of bounded discriminant that can be embedded into a quaternionic or a dihedral extension. To prove these results, we express the solvability of these inverse Galois problems in terms of Hilbert symbols, and then apply a method of Heath-Brown to bound sums of linked quadratic characters.
